Shree Cement, BPCL, JSW Steel, ITI in focus
23-May-23 08:40Hrs IST

Shree Cement: The company's consolidated net profit fell to Rs 525.21 crore in Q4 FY23 as against a net profit of Rs 659.08 crore in Q4 FY22. Total income advanced to Rs 5245.91 crore in the quarter ended 31 March 2023 from Rs 4501.60 crore recorded in Q4 FY22.

BPCL: The company's consolidated net profit rose to Rs 6,870.47 crore in Q4 FY23 as against a net profit of Rs 2,559.17 crore in Q4 FY22. Total income advanced to Rs 1,33,902.66 crore in the quarter ended 31 March 2023 from Rs 1,24,026.81 crore recorded in Q4 FY22.

Indiabulls Housing Finance: The company's consolidated net profit fell to Rs 263 crore in Q4 FY23 as against a net profit of Rs 307 crore in Q4 FY22. Total income advanced to Rs 2077 crore in the quarter ended 31 March 2023 from Rs 2191 crore recorded in Q4 FY22.

JSW Steel: JSW Steel and JFE Steel, Japan have in‐principle reached an agreement to establish a 50:50 Joint Venture Company (?JV?). The JV shall be able to manufacture the entire range of CRGO products at its proposed facilities at Vijayanagar, Karnataka.

ITI: ITI has bagged an Advance Purchase Order (APO) from BSNL worth Rs. 3889 crore for its 4G rollout. BSNL has issued an Advance Purchase Order (APO) for Reservation Quota (RQ) Order in the West Zone.

Astra Microwave Products: The company's joint venture company, Astra Rafael Comsys, has bagged Rs.158 crore worth of order from Defence Public Sector Undertaking (DPSU) for supply of Software Defined Radio (SDR).

Torrent Power: The meeting of the board of directors of the company is scheduled on 29 May 2023 to consider and approve raising of funds by issuance of Non-Convertible Debentures upto Rs 3,000 crore through private placement basis.
